City Center Planned District
The B-3.5 city center planned district is intended to implement the Old Town Manassas Sector Plan, to encourage the mixing of compatible land uses, and to permit flexibility in building design and use. The goals of this district include extending the architecture and feel of historic downtown outside its core areas to create a sense of continuity, permitting increased residential development at urban densities in proximity to the Virginia Railway Express train station, and encouraging high-quality innovative design, infill, and redevelopment projects that are compatible with existing residential and commercial uses.
